The Cijin Shell Museum (Chinese: 旗津貝殼博物館; pinyin: Qíjīn Bèiké Bówùguǎn) is a museum in Qijin District, Kaohsiung, Taiwan.[1]

Architecture

The museum building occupies the top floor of the white, gray-blue and light blue building. The ground floor of the building is the Cijin Seaside Park tourist service center.[2][3]

Exhibition

The museum houses more than 200 kinds of shrimps and crabs specimens as well as more than 2,000 kinds of shellfish specimens, including three kinds of 'living fossil' Nautilus.
